A director at Ystrad Mynach based firm Utility and Environmental Solutions (UES) has been highly commended at a prestigious business award.
UES non-executive director Andrew Padmore received the accolade at the Institute of Directors (IoD) Director of the Year Awards in London.
Mr Padmore was honoured alongside other Welsh business directors.
IoD Wales director Robert Lloyd Griffiths said: “This event celebrated the very best in British business and it was wonderful that three Welsh enterprise leaders were among those in the spotlight.
“It’s well document how times are difficult just now, but individuals who practice leadership at the same level as those honoured will be among those crucial to building the economy once more.”
Those to be highly commended were:
Ben Roberts, managing director of Clogau Gold of Wales, Bodelwyddan, near Rhyl (family business category); Huw Jones, managing director and chairman of Jones Bros Civil Engineering, of Ruthin, near Wrexham (family business); and Andrew Padmore, managing director of energy consultancy UES (environmental leadership).
Also shortlisted were Claire Evans, chief financial officer of Atlas Elektronik, Newport (young director category); and Drewe Lacey, chairman of Alchemy Wealth Management, Chepstow (family business category).
